Rooms Rita - Dubrovnik
42.65097, 18.09841Situated in Gruz with a busy ferry port and marina, the 3-star Rooms Rita Dubrovnik hotel gives access to entertainment venues like Pile Gate, approximately 25 minutes' walk away. The guest house provides guests with Wi-Fi throughout the property.
Location
Rector's Palace is nearly a 25-minute walk from this property, while Muralles de Dubrovnik is approximately 25 minutes' walk away. The hotel is opposite Aquapark Cavtat and 25 km from Dubrovnik airport. The best historical sights to visit here include the massive oceanside fortress "Fort Bokar", situated about 25 minutes' walk from the accommodation.
Hebranga 3 bus stop is just a short drive from Rooms Rita hotel.
Rooms
The rooms at the property have high-speed internet and a television, along with tea/coffee making equipment for your convenience. Ironing facilities and air conditioning are featured for guests' comfort. These rooms have private bathrooms with a separate toilet and a shower, along with a hair dryer and bath sheets. Enjoy views of the sea, while staying at this Dubrovnik hotel.
Eat & Drink
Restaurant Vapor has its own variety of Mediterranean meals and is just 12 minutes' walk away.

During Christmas, I stayed in a lovely home stay that offered a beautiful balcony with stunning views of the city and the sea. The host, a kind and lovely lady, made us feel at home and even cooked us soup when we caught a cold. we had full access to the kitchen with a dishwasher, a separate fridge, and Wi-Fi. The location was ideal, as we had easy access to public transportation and it was only a 20-minute uphill walk to the city center.
The room did not have heating during my stay, which made it a bit uncomfortable at times. , it was not clear when I booked that we would be sharing the apartment with the host.
